Official title

A Phase 1-2 Dose-Escalation and Safety Study of ADXS31-142 Alone and of ADXS31-142 in Combination With Pembrolizumab (MK-3475) in Patients With Previously Treated Metastatic Castration-Resistant Prostate Cancer

Study identification

NCT ID
NCT02325557
Recruitment status
Completed
Study type
Interventional
Phase
Phase 1, Phase 2
Lead sponsor
Advaxis, Inc.
Industry
Enrollment
50 participants
